Duties And Responsibilities
Responsible for the day-to-day management of operations of Carleton’s animal facilities (core vivaria and satellite facilities), and optimization of services to animal researchers. Supports the University Veterinarian in ensuring CU’s animal facilities supports the university’s teaching and research requirements and adheres to the Ontario Ministry of Agricultural Food and Rural Affairs (OMAFRA), Animals for Research Act (ARA), Canadian Council of Animal Care (CCAC) and Institutional Animals Care Committee (ACC) standards and guidelines.
